实现"mysql同一字段值循环拼接"的方法
作为一名经验丰富的开发者,我们经常需要处理类似的需求,今天我将教你如何实现在MySQL中同一字段值循环拼接的方法。首先,我们来看整个实现的流程,然后逐步说明每一步需要做什么。
实现流程
步骤 | 操作 |
---|---|
1 | 查询需要拼接的字段值 |
2 | 循环遍历字段值并拼接 |
3 | 输出拼接后的结果 |
步骤详解
步骤1:查询需要拼接的字段值
在MySQL中,我们可以使用如下SQL语句查询需要拼接的字段值:
```sql
SELECT field_name
FROM table_name;
其中,`field_name`为需要拼接的字段名,`table_name`为表名。
#### 步骤2:循环遍历字段值并拼接
接下来,我们需要在代码中使用循环来遍历字段值并拼接。在MySQL中,我们可以使用`GROUP_CONCAT`函数来实现该功能。代码如下:
```markdown
```sql
SET @result='';
SELECT GROUP_CONCAT(field_name SEPARATOR ',')
INTO @result
FROM table_name;
其中,`field_name`为需要拼接的字段名,`table_name`为表名。`SEPARATOR ','`表示以逗号作为分隔符拼接字段值。
#### 步骤3:输出拼接后的结果
最后,我们将拼接后的结果输出。代码如下:
```markdown
```sql
SELECT @result;
### 总结
通过以上步骤,我们可以实现在MySQL中同一字段值循环拼接的功能。希望这篇文章对你有所帮助,如果有任何疑问,欢迎随时向我提问。
**引用形式的描述信息:** 以上是实现"mysql同一字段值循环拼接"的方法,希望能对你有所帮助。
在工作中,遇到问题并不可怕,关键是要善于查找解决方法,不断学习和提升自己的能力。祝你在开发的道路上一帆风顺!